Output dd8f23bab2a0ac04cd7f8712e6d5d16dff0ef0548ed7d8a7cf04de2fd5bcb240:3

value
23560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d42321cbfc421d97bd7475784c7cd65925e980 OP_EQUAL
address
31mQ46bFXLXJnnvMxjP1XMyTs44E9sNP5t
transaction
dd8f23bab2a0ac04cd7f8712e6d5d16dff0ef0548ed7d8a7cf04de2fd5bcb240
spent
true